Seals that are degrading
Because bifold doors are continuously exposed to the elements, their seals could be damaged over time. This is not only unsightly but also can lead to leaks of water, draughts and lower efficiency of energy. To ensure that you keep your home dry and warm you must repair any deteriorating seals frequently.
A frequent issue is leak coming from the bottom of your bifold door. This needs to be addressed immediately. The first step is determine where the leak is coming from. There could be a number of reasons, so it is important to get your bifold doors checked by an expert.
The simplest cause of leaks is that the sill isn't sealed correctly. To stop this from happening, the cill has to be sealed against damp. The gaps must also be filled with silicone. If your aluminum casing has drainage holes, it is recommended to also fill the holes with silicone (a professional installer can do this). Another possible cause of leaks could be that the internal draughtseal has worn down and is no longer doing its job of keeping the doors shut. A professional can replace the existing seal with a new one to stop air from leaking into your home.
If the seal on your bottom is damaged or worn out, you should replace it. It is simple to perform, but it should only be performed by a professional as they will use a high-quality replacement that is able to withstand the rigours of regular use.
In addition to replacing the seal on the bottom and cleaning your bifold doors' exteriors frequently using a mild mixture of cleaning liquid and water. This will prevent the build-up of dirt and grime, which could cause hardware issues. It is also a good idea to conduct an annual maintenance of your bifold doors. This includes a complete integrity check and lubrication of the hardware.

Dirty Tracks
Bifold doors are designed and engineered to be sturdy and durable However, they require the right care and maintenance to keep them in good working order. If the hinges or tracks get dirty, they may stop the bifold doors from opening and closing properly. This could cause damage to the door seals. It is important to keep these mechanisms clean and well-lubricated.
This is especially true of the track that runs along the bottom of the bifold door. It can become obstructed by debris, like large leaves or stones. This could stop the bi folding door repair from sliding smoothly and forming a seal when closed. It is possible to solve this issue by regularly cleaning the track and removing any debris.
You could also try a silicone spray, or a different type of household lubricant to see whether it helps them move more easily. You can always ask an expert for assistance when you're not sure how to proceed.
In certain instances, it may be the case that the bi fold door repairs is jammed or caught on the bottom of track. In this case the lock might need to be removed. This should only be done by experts who are skilled in doing this safely.
When homeowners find that their bifold doors aren't opening or closing as effortlessly as they did in the past they might need to call a bifold repair expert. This is a frequent problem that can be repaired by ensuring that the hinges and track are regularly cleaned and free of debris. It is crucial to ensure that the sills and frame aren't damaged and that the water drains efficiently.
Out of Alignment
The bifold door seal repair door system is a fantastic way to connect different living areas. However, their complicated mechanisms require expert installation and regular maintenance to function effectively. If your bifold door isn't closing correctly, it could indicate that the doors are damaged and require replacement.
Even bifold doors made by reputable manufacturers experience problems with their mechanisms over time, particularly after prolonged use. A common problem is that doors can drop or become misaligned. This could make it difficult to open or close them, and also creating drafts or creating a hazardous work environment for your family and you.
If your bifold door is dropping it is important to check the hinges and pivot brackets. They should be snug and secure, but they may loosen over time and cause friction, making it difficult to move bifold doors. This is a simple problem to solve. Apply lubricant to the pivot brackets and hinges and then tighten them once more.
It is also recommended to lubricate your locking mechanism. It is essential to do this to ensure your lock functions properly and doesn't damage bifold doors. Utilizing lubricant made of silicone on the locks will decrease friction and help it to operate smoothly.
In addition, check the alignment of the individual panels. If one panel is higher than the other, it may be difficult to close and can also cause other issues, like broken or loose tracks. If you notice any unevenness you can loosen the adjusting screws on the top or bottom of each panel to either raise or lower it. Make small adjustments and inspect the level of each door regularly until you're satisfied that they're all in line with the frame and with each other.
It is important to clean and grease your bifold doors to ensure they're functional and effective in the long run. Broken Hardware
The hardware for bifold doors may need replacement or repair from time to time. It is essential that repairs are completed by professionals.
The quality of your bifold door's hardware can affect their performance and lifespan. Hinges, rollers and tracks are all included. These components are usually made out of metal or plastic. These components are designed for long-term usage however, they may wear out due to aging or overuse.
There are a few common indicators that you need to replace the bifold door hardware. This includes sticking doors, misalignment and obvious wear and tear. Most of the time minor issues can be fixed by simple repairs, but major damage or worn-out components will need to be replaced.
The hardware of your bifold door can be top-hung or bottom-rolling. If your bifold doors repair doors are top-hung they will be suspended from a track that is at the top of the frame. On the other hand, if your bifold doors are bottom rolling, they will run along the bottom track.
The hardware on your bifold doors is constructed from a range of materials such as steel, aluminium and brass. The components can be painted or powder coated to match the interior design scheme. It is important to know that hardware for bifold doors is brand-named by the manufacturer. It is not possible to change the hardware on your bifold doors with a different brand.
The majority of the hardware in your bifold door will have to be maintained and lubricated regularly. This will allow them to perform better and improve the longevity of your doors.
